<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">Description.</paragraph>
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">
Tree, up to 10 m tall, d.b.h. 17 cm; stilt roots or buttresses absent. Indumentum of simple hairs; old leafless branches glabrous, young foliate branches sparsely pubescent. Leaves: petiole 6-8 mm long, 2-3 mm in diameter, pubescent, cylindrical, blade inserted on top of the petiole; blade 23.5-36.5 cm long, 6.5-8.5 cm wide,
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="1">narrowly to very narrowly elliptic or narrowly obovate (rarely)</emphasis>
, apex obtuse, base obtuse, papyraceous, below sparsely pubescent when young and old, above glabrous when young and old, discolorous, whitish below; midrib impressed, above pubescent when young and old, below pubescent when young, glabrous when old; secondary veins 22 to 32 pairs, glabrous above; tertiary venation percurrent. Individuals bisexual; inflorescence cauliflorous or ramiflorous on old leafless branches, axillary, peduncle like base 15-30 mm long, axial internodes 1-50 mm long,
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="1">lax or panicle-like</emphasis>
, sympodial rachis 30-100 mm long. Flowers with 9 perianth parts in 3 whorls, 2 to 5 per inflorescence; pedicel 5-7 mm long, ca. 2 mm in diameter, densely pubescent; in fruit 15 mm long, 3 mm in diameter, pubescent; basal bract ca. 3 mm long, ca. 3 mm wide; upper bract ca. 2 mm long, ca. 2 mm wide; sepals 3, valvate, free, 2-3 mm long, 2-3 mm wide, ovate, apex acute, base truncate, brown, pubescent outside, glabrous inside, margins flat; petals free, outer petals shorter than inner; outer petals 3, 5-6 mm long, ca. 5 mm wide, obovate, apex acute, base truncate, pale yellow to cream, margins flat, pubescent outside, glabrous inside; inner petals 3, valvate, 30-40 mm long, 8-10 mm wide, elliptic, apex acute, base truncate, pale yellow to cream, margins wavy, densely pubescent outside, pubescent inside; stamens numerous, in 6 to 8 rows, 1-2 mm long, broad; connective discoid, glabrous, red; staminodes absent;
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="1">carpels free, 4</emphasis>
, ovary ca. 2 mm long, stigma globose, pubescent. Monocarps sessile, 1 to 3, 21-43 mm long, 27-53 mm in diameter, ellipsoid, apex rounded,
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="1">pubescent, verrucose with short flat projections, not ribbed, light red all over when ripe</emphasis>
; seeds up to 6 per monocarp, ca. 16 mm long, ca. 10 mm in diameter,
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="1">transversely ellipsoid</emphasis>
; aril absent.
</paragraph>

<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">Distribution.</paragraph>
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">endemic to Cameroon, known from the South and South-West regions.</paragraph>
</subSubSection>
<subSubSection pageId="0" pageNumber="1" type="habitat">
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">Habitat.</paragraph>
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">A very rare species known from five collections; in primary rain forest on well-drained sandy soils, intermixed with crystalline rocks. Altitude c. 100 m a.s.l.</paragraph>

<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">Notes.</paragraph>
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="1">
<taxonomicName authorityName="Ghogue, Sonke &amp; Couvreur, Pl. Ecol. Evol. 150 (2): 201" authorityYear="2017" class="Magnoliopsida" family="Annonaceae" genus="Piptostigma" higherTaxonomySource="CoL" kingdom="Plantae" lsidName="Piptostigma mayndongtsaeanum" order="Magnoliales" pageId="0" pageNumber="1" phylum="Tracheophyta" rank="species" species="mayndongtsaeanum">
<emphasis italics="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="1">Piptostigma mayndongtsaeanum</emphasis>
</taxonomicName>
differs from other species of the genus by the narrow shape of its leaf blade (from narrowly to very narrowly elliptic) and the shape of its monocarps (transversely ellipsoid).
